Popular Post placeholder Posted May 26, 2023 Popular Post Share Posted May 26, 2023 Kissinger at 100: How his ‘sordid’ diplomacy in Africa fuelled war in Angola and prolonged apartheid https://www.theguardian.com/global-development/2023/may/25/henry-kissinger-100-strategic-genius-or-damaging-diplomacy-held-back-africa Yet Another Disgrace On December 7, 1975, Indonesia invaded East Timor. Less than twenty-four hours before the invasion, President Ford and his secretary of state, Henry Kissinger, met with Suharto, Indonesia’s dictator, in Jakarta. Kissinger would later insist that he and Ford had not talked about East Timor while meeting with Suharto (an assertion that would be proven false by the release of a damning transcript showing Ford and Kissinger essentially giving the autocrat their blessing to invade). https://newrepublic.com/article/78704/yet-another-disgrace-east-timor-genocide 2 1 1 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Attorney for Henry Kissinger tells jurors he invested $6 million in Theranos after meeting Elizabeth Holmes SAN JOSE, CALIF. -- A former estate attorney told jurors in Elizabeth Holmes’ criminal trial that he invested $6 million in Theranos after being introduced to Holmes by ex-Secretary of State Henry Kissinger. Daniel Mosley, who counted Kissinger as a client, took the stand on Tuesday in week nine of the trial. He said that he first heard of the blood-testing start-up in 2013 through Kissinger, who was one of several high-profile former government officials on the Theranos board. “Dr. Kissinger explained to me he was on the board of Theranos and that it was a very interesting company,” Mosely said. “He said it would be terrific if you would take the time to learn about the company and give me your views on it.” https://www.cnbc.com/2021/11/02/attorney-of-henry-kissinger-put-6-million-in-theranos-due-to-holmes.html Henry Kissinger: Kissinger served on Theranos' board from 2014 to 2017. The former Secretary of State resigned amid questions about the company's practices. https://summitjunto.co/articles/what-happened-to-theranos-board-of-directors Edited May 28, 2023 by bamnutsak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
